El Cerrito has a population of 25,994 with a median age of 41.8. Here is the racial and ethnic breakdown of the population:
| Demographic | Value |
|---|---|
| Total Population | 25,994 |
| Median Age | 41.8 |
| White | 45.7% |
| Black or African American | 5.5% |
| Asian | 28.5% |
| Hispanic or Latino | 14.8% |
| Other / Two or More Races | 5.5% |
The median household income in El Cerrito is $127,876, which is 58.6% above the national median of $80,610. The per capita income is $73,055. The poverty rate is 6.9%.
The unemployment rate in El Cerrito is 3.9%, compared to the national rate of 4.1%.

In El Cerrito, 96.3% of residents age 25+ have a high school diploma or higher, and 67.6% hold a bachelor's degree or higher (32.2% with a graduate or professional degree).
| Education Level | % of Adults (25+) |
|---|---|
| High School Diploma or Higher | 96.3% |
| Bachelor's Degree or Higher | 67.6% |
| Graduate or Professional Degree | 32.2% |
The median home value in El Cerrito is $1,124,400, above the national median of $303,400. The median monthly rent is $2,548. The homeownership rate is 58.6%.
| Housing Metric | Value |
|---|---|
| Median Home Value | $1,124,400 |
| Median Monthly Rent | $2,548 |
| Homeownership Rate | 58.6% |
| Vacancy Rate | 3.7% |
